ASHEBORO — A treasure among us. Neal Griffin faithfully served God, his wife, his family, his friends, his customers, and his neighbors. He was a giver, willing to help anyone with anything. He had a sharp mind and a quick wit. He adored his wife, Libby, whom he met before he was even a teenager. Neal and Libby did everything closely together throughout their lives.

Cornelius ‘Neal” Griffin, Jr., 85, of Asheboro, passed away peacefully on April 12, 2026. Neal was born on Feb. 17, 1941, in Wake Forest, NC, to Cornelius and Jessie Cone Griffin. 

He was a loving father, grandfather, brother, uncle, and friend. He was a member and longtime servant at Sunset Avenue Church of God. Professionally, he was Operations Manager at Automatic Vending Service for over 50 years. 

Neal was gifted at problem solving. He had the ability to repair almost any piece of equipment, specializing in small motors, electrical devices and refrigeration, which he started learning as a teen at Electric Motor Shop of Wake Forest. Being from Wake Forest, he was an avid, lifelong fan of Wake Forest University sports, particularly football and basketball.

Neal lived an active 85 years, making the most of any situation, seeking to see everything and everyone through His Lord and Savior. Neal and Libby are together again, in eternity.

He is survived by his son, Cornelius “Neal” Griffin, III (Jennifer) of Asheboro; daughter, Elizabeth “Deanna” Clement (Matt) of Asheboro; sister, Renda Gwaltney (Bob) of Concord; sister, Dovie Feher (Dave) of Myrtle Beach; grandchildren, Christian O’Briant of Concord, Elizabeth O’Briant of Cameron, Lucy Griffin of Charlotte, Jessie Griffin of Charlotte, and Harrison Clement of Raleigh.
In addition to his parents, Neal was predeceased in death by his wife of almost 64 years, Libby Griffin; son, Marty Griffin; son, Chris Griffin (widow, Stacy); brother, Bill Griffin (Nellie); and sister, Lola Jarrell (Max).
